About This Opportunity

The Professor Tony Parker Scholarship in Industrial Design is designed for promising students majoring in industrial design at undergraduate level or in industrial design and its related fields at postgraduate level. This scholarship is supported by research fees accumulated by former staff member and Emeritus Professor Tony Parker, whose research practice focused on aesthetically driven affective product design, including product desirability, usability, experience, branding and innovation for improved user satisfaction. The scholarship aims to support high achieving students at both undergraduate and postgraduate level with a passion for industrial design. The award is valued at $5,000 for one year and is available to one student per year. Applicants must be New Zealand citizens or permanent residents enrolled full-time at the College of Creative Arts, Wellington, with a GPA of 7.5 or above. Selection considers academic achievements, references, and financial situation.
